description 碩士 === 南台科技大學 === 多媒體與電腦娛樂科學系 === 97 === According to the ergonomics improvement, usability has been seen as (becom) one important factor in the field of software design. Besides, whether software is successful usually depends on the design of usability. However, for left -handed users, the design of usability nowadays is not completely suitable. In fact, most lefthanders get used to products that are built for right-handers, namely, few lefthanders are willing to change accommodated right-handed habits to adapt to left-handed settings. Taking the operation interface of FPS for example, function keys are usually set on the right side of a keyboard or a control panel; nevertheless, left-handed users may be unhandy to operate a keyboard based on a right-handed setting. Thus, the present research focuses on examining the settings of right-handed keyboards and finding out what operational problems will happen and appear when a left-hander plays a FPS game with right-handed device. In order to investigating and analyzing operational problems, there are some main sections in the study as follows. First, I explored left-hand players’ efficiency of the using mouse and keyboard. Second, I also investigated if the coordinate ability would affect a participant’s speed reaction. For the purpose of the study, I asked left-handed and right-handed participants to have 3 different types of action. They are active operation, passive operation and Asymmetric bimanual operation. The data gathered in the test was analyzed by T-test. And I also gathered some participants’ background information for Correlation Analysis. The data gathered in the examination were used to find out the performance when players play PC by using right-handed and left-handed setting. From the result, I discovered that left-handed users had lesser problems using two different settings than right-handed users had. And their operation performances in using left-handed and right-handed keyboard settings are about the same. In contrast, right-handed users had better performance in using right-handed setting. Besides, in the study I also found that participants’ background information has no connection between their operating performances. Summing up upper research results, we could see that left-handed examinees had nearly equal performances in using left-handed and right-handed keyboard settings. Even they didn’t have a chance to practice before having tests. And also we could see the background has no relation with operating performance both in right-handers and left-handers.
